    Christian Church Services
There will be preaching servi­
ces at the Church o f Christ each
Lords day morning and evening,
during the summer months.
The Bible school convenes at 10
A. M. followed by preaching at
11 o ’clock.
The E n d e a v o r
League meets each alternate Sun­
day evening with the Methodist
and Church o f Christ at 7 P. M.
Preaching services at 8 P. M.
All are invited.

Otis Wagner and Carl Kimmel
of the 3rd Oregon Infantry, now
stationed at Clacknmas, visited
their homes in Estacada Wednes­
day and attended commence­
ment exercises that evening.

Viola Breezes
Contributed
The last day of school on Fri­
day was enjoyed by about sixty
parents and friends o f the school.
Miss Woodle, the teacher, had
prepared a fine program, after
which a big dinner was disposed
of, with sufficient ice cream sold
to pay for the cream and leav" a
balance, which will go to the Vi­
ola Women’s Club.
